Before the much-anticipated clash on September 13, 2025, between the Utah Utes and the Wyoming Cowboys, fans and bettors alike are gearing up for a thrilling Saturday football showdown. Set to take place at Jonah Field at War Memorial Stadium in Laramie, WY, this game promises to deliver excitement as both teams vie for victory in the NCAAF league. With the game broadcasted on CBS Sports Network, viewers can catch every moment live.
For those interested in player props, this matchup offers intriguing opportunities. Utah's Devon Dampier has a 61.8% hit rate for under 1.5 passing touchdowns, presenting a high EV bet. Meanwhile, Wyoming's Kaden Anderson is projected with a 36.1% hit rate for over 0.5 passing touchdowns, though with a lower EV.
